It seems that in low light situations, I can only get the right red led to light up. In testing this, I set the ISO so that I can use 1/30 sec and below. The problem only shows in these slower times. I will meter and get the over exposure led to come on. Then I start turing he apeture ring to the left, but the left led never comes on. The right one is either full on bright, or off. At one click of the apeture ring, I would expect the right light to get dimmer and the left light to come on a little. It doesn't happen. The right light just goes blank.
I have cleaned all the contacts and put in brand new batteries. Any thoughts?
